WebMar 20, 2024 · BC Housing has selected the Port Alberni Friendship Centre (PAFC) as the new operator of the Our Home at 8th supportive housing and shelter building in Port Alberni. PAFC will begin managing Our Home on 8th, located at 3939 8th Ave., on April 1, 2024, taking over from the Port Alberni Shelter Society. There will be no interruption of services ... WebFeb 23, 2024 · A Housing Needs Report presented to Port Alberni city council on Feb. 22 showed that between 2006 and 2016 the average rent in Port Alberni increased by 37 per cent, but the median income for renters fell by 0.9 per cent. The report also indicated that since 2015 housing prices have increased by about 53 per cent.
